The Muonionalusta Meteorite Cabochon is a rare and remarkable gemstone material sourced from one of Earth's oldest known meteorite strikes. This iron meteorite fell to Earth over one million years ago, originating from the core of a celestial body, and was discovered in northern Sweden near the Arctic Circle. Each oval cabochon measures 16mm x 12mm and displays the iconic Widmanstätten Pattern — a breathtaking natural crystalline structure that formed over billions of years as the meteorite slowly cooled in space. No two specimens are identical, making every cabochon a genuinely one-of-a-kind material for jewelry designers and metalsmiths.
These calibrated cabochons are etched to reveal their extraordinary internal structure and nickel-plated to protect against rust.
